Several matches are scheduled for February 16, 2026, including Sofia Kenin vs. Clara Tauson. Kenin's current record is 1-5 for the year, while Tauson stands at 4-5.
Other notable matches include Rebecca Sramkova vs. Varvara Gracheva, Kamilla Rakhimova vs. Iva Jovic, and Elena-Gabriela Ruse vs. Emma Navarro.
Top contenders for winning the 2026 WTA Dubai include Elena Rybakina (+275), Coco Gauff (+750), and Amanda Anisimova (+800).
Several seeded players, including those seeded 9-16, are in action today, hoping to avoid early exits, as seen with Daria Kasatkina and Beatriz Haddad Maia in the previous year.
